Political Parties’ Coalition Urges OYSIEC Boss To Resign

Oyo Independence Electoral Commission, (OYSIEC) boss, Mr.Olajide Ajekiigbe has been asked to resign his appointment.

Making the urge in Ibadan during a private radio discussion, representative of the coalition of Political Parties in the State, Mr. Gbenga Olayemi, who doubles as the Chairman, Labour Party in the State said for the OYSIEC boss to protect his dignity, he should resign the assignment given to him by the State Government because there is no way he can deliver the assignment without being partial to the All Progressives Congress, the party that gave him the job.

Both Mr. Gbenga Olayemi of the Labour Party and Dr. Babarinde Ademola of the People Democratic Party said the OYSIEC boss is a man of reputation but there is no way the State Government will not damage his reputation through the responsibility assigned to him.

They alleged that the ruling political parties in Nigeria have always not been sincere with conduct of local government elections in their states.

Representing coalition of about twenty two political parties of the Accord, Labour party, People Democratic Congress, and others, the two men blamed the State Government under the leadership of Senator Abiola Ajimobi of the delay in conducting local government in the State.

They said it is not even certain whether the local government election announced by the State Government will still hold on Saturday 12th day of May as announced because according to them, up till now, no serious preparation has been made by the State Government on the conduct of the election in the State.

The men, urged the people of Oyo State to shine their eyes when it is time for the general election as people in the ruling All Progressive Congress and the opposition, People Democratic Party have failed Nigerians.
